Welcome to Florida. If only I had a sand dollar for every time an odd occurrence was explained away with the unique expression: Welcome to Florida.
My wife, Vikki, and I decided to leave our home state of Wisconsin and follow our dream with a move to paradise, known to us as Florida. We had vacationed in the Sunshine State many times, and the sun and the sand had always called our names, so we finally followed the calling and landed in the town of Punta Gorda, just north of Fort Myers on the Gulf side of the state.
For the most part, paradise was just as we'd imagined, but as we settled into our new home, we experienced many quirky and previously unknown facts of life. Turns out, Florida is not all Mickey Mouse and beaches.
Several of our neighbors and colleagues are transplants themselves, experiencing many of the same abnormalities on their own when making the move south. As we shared our anecdotal stories with our now fellow Floridians, we were frequently met with that simple phrase in response: Welcome to Florida.
I began to jot down these stories so that we might have more to offer future Floridians when they shared their tales with us. As I abbreviated the phrase "Welcome to Florida," I realized quickly that the acronym was WTF! It seemed appropriate that the common slang for "What the f----!" shared an abbreviation with the three words we heard so often.
As you read about our
Welcome to Florida
journey, you too might find yourself shaking your head and saying, "WTF!"
